Lemon Grove residential calls split between rental-cycle work and resale work. Property managers and small-portfolio landlords handle rekey at every tenant turnover, typically three to four cylinders per unit (quoted by the locksmith from the cylinders on the doors), often with mailbox lock rekey or replacement added when the mailbox key disappears with the moved-out tenant. Resale rekey for owner-occupied home sales runs the standard three to five cylinders (quoted by the locksmith from the actual doors), often paired with a Grade 2 deadbolt upgrade on the front door for buyers replacing original hardware that has been on the door for decades.

Multi-family common-area work along the apartment building stock generates regular cylinder service, front entries, side entries, mail rooms, and laundry rooms all run on rekey cycles when the building manager changes or when keys go missing. Most multi-family work is invoiced direct to the property management company.

The Broadway commercial corridor adds steady small-shop work. Tenant rekey when retail or restaurant spaces change hands, back-of-house and office cylinder service, file cabinet and small-safe work, and commercial lockout response are the standard call types. My 1950s Lemon Grove ranch has original cylinders, what should I plan for?

Original cylinders are well past their useful service life after decades of use. Pins are worn, springs are weak, and thumb turns are loose or stiff. Practical sequence: rekey first to a new common key so you control access (quoted by the locksmith from the cylinders on the doors for a typical three-to-five-cylinder home), then upgrade the front door to a Grade 2 deadbolt (quoted installed by the locksmith) within the next year as budget allows. Back and garage entry doors follow over time. Front-door priority is right because that is the door most likely to be targeted by an intruder.

Where can I get keys made near me in Lemon Grove?

An independent locksmith can often cut and copy keys at your Lemon Grove address: house keys, mailbox and office keys, and many car keys with a transponder or fob. A mobile locksmith is often the closest option because they bring a key machine with them. Swift Key does not own those vans. Hardware stores and kiosks handle plain brass blanks, but they cannot cut a restricted keyway, decode an original too worn to trace, or program a chip. Restricted keyways still need a manufacturer-authorized dealer. Swift Key is not that dealer.
